Ingredients for strawberry daiquiri recipe
To make a perfect Strawberry Daiquiri, you’ll need a few simple ingredients:
• Frozen strawberries: Provides the creamy base of the drink.
• Fresh strawberries: Adds a vibrant, fresh flavor.
• Lime juice: Brings a tart, refreshing kick to balance the sweetness.
• Coconut rum (or white rum): Gives the daiquiri its signature rum flavor with a hint of tropical coconut.
• Simple syrup: Sweetens the drink and balances the tartness of the strawberries.

Step-by-Step Instructions
Making this Strawberry Daiquiri is quick and easy. Here’s how you can prepare it:
- Make the simple syrup: In a saucepan, combine equal parts water and granulated sugar. Heat over medium, stirring until the sugar dissolves completely. Let it cool.
- Prepare the blender: In a blender, combine frozen strawberries, fresh strawberries, lime juice, rum, and simple syrup.
- Blend until smooth: Blend until the mixture is creamy and smooth. If it’s too thin, add more frozen strawberries to thicken it up.
- Serve and garnish: Pour into chilled glasses, topping with extra rum or whipped cream if desired. Garnish with a fresh strawberry or maraschino cherry.
Tips & Tricks for the Best strawberry daiquiri recipe
To elevate your daiquiri experience, follow these handy tips:
• No ice needed: Frozen strawberries create the perfect texture. Avoid using ice, as it will dilute the flavor.
• Adjust sweetness: Taste your daiquiri and add more simple syrup if you prefer a sweeter drink.
• Check consistency: If the drink is too runny, simply add more frozen strawberries. For a thicker consistency, blend longer or add ice.
• Make it virgin: Omit the rum to enjoy a non-alcoholic version.

FAQ About strawberry daiquiri recipe
Can I make a strawberry daiquiri without alcohol?
Yes! To make a non-alcoholic version of this strawberry daiquiri, simply omit the rum and replace it with a bit of sparkling water or lemon-lime soda for a refreshing mocktail. You can also add a touch of honey or agave for extra sweetness.
How do I store leftover strawberry daiquiris?
Since strawberry daiquiris are best served fresh, they’re not ideal for long-term storage. However, if you have leftovers, you can store the drink in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 24 hours. For best results, blend it again before serving.
Can I use frozen strawberries for the strawberry daiquiri?
Absolutely! Frozen strawberries work wonderfully in this recipe and can actually give your daiquiri a thicker, slushier texture. They’re perfect for when fresh strawberries aren’t in season or if you’re looking to make a chilled, ice-cold beverage.

Delicious Strawberry Daiquiri
- Total Time: 5 minutes
- Yield: 2 servings 1x
Description
This strawberry daiquiri recipe delivers a refreshing, sweet cocktail that’s perfect for summer. With a mix of fresh strawberries, rum, and lime juice, it’s a tropical treat in every sip.
Ingredients
- 2 cups fresh strawberries
- 1/4 cup white rum
- 1 tablespoon lime juice
- 1 tablespoon simple syrup
- 1 cup ice cubes
Instructions
- In a blender, combine the strawberries, white rum, lime juice, simple syrup, and ice cubes.
- Blend until smooth and creamy.
- Pour the mixture into a chilled glass.
- Garnish with a strawberry or lime wedge if desired, and serve immediately.
Notes
- Frozen strawberries can be used for a thicker, slushier texture.
- If you prefer a sweeter drink, adjust the amount of simple syrup to taste.
- For a non-alcoholic version, omit the rum and replace with sparkling water or lemon-lime soda.
